TechRadar Verdict Ted Lasso season 4 will make you believe that it was the right decision for the hit Apple TV show to take to the field once more. Its first four episodes ship an own goal or two, but it's nevertheless a joyous return to form for the Jason Sudeikis-led sports comedy-drama that fans new and old will get more than a kick out of. Light spoilers follow for Ted Lasso season 4 episodes 1 to 4.Ted Lasso is back — and so, too, is Apple TV’s hugely popular sports comedy-drama.
